发明名称 CONOSCOPIC ILLUMINATION OPTICAL DEVICE WITH A HOLLOW CONE FOR AN OPTICAL MICROSCOPE AND METHOD OF OPTICAL MICROSCOPY IN CONOSCOPY
摘要 A method of microscopy and an illumination optical device with a hollow cone for a microscope, the illumination device includes a first conical lens (1) able to receive a collimated incident light beam (10) and form a conical light beam (20), a second conical lens (5) arranged in such a way as to receive the conical light beam (20, 40) and to form a cylindrical light beam with a black background (50) and an optical lens (6) having an image focal plane (12) arranged in such a way as to receive the cylindrical light beam with a black background (50), to form a hollow cone light beam (60) and to focus the hollow cone light beam (60) into a point (18) in the image focal plane (12).

A hollow-cone and point-focusing conoscopic illumination optical device for an optical microscope, comprising: illumination means comprising a point light source, said illumination means being able to generate a collimated incident light beam (10), an optical objective (6) having an optical axis (8, 8′) and an image focal plane (12), the optical objective (6) being arranged so as to receive a cylindrical incident light beam (50) and to form an image of the source at one point (18) in the image focal point (12), characterized in that the illumination optical device comprises: an optical system comprising a first conical lens (1) and a second conical lens (5), said optical beam being arranged on the optical path of the incident light beam between the illumination means and the optical objective (6), the first conical lens (1) being arranged so as to receive said collimated incident light beam (10) and to form a hollow-cone light beam (20) having, in a plane transverse to the beam axis, a light distribution comprising a dark central part and a bright ring part, the second conical lens (5) being arranged so as to receive said first hollow-cone light beam (20, 40) from the first conical lens (1) and to form a black-background cylindrical light beam (50) having, in a plane transverse to the beam axis, a light distribution comprising a dark central part and a bright ring part, and in that the optical objective (6) is arranged so as to receive said black-background cylindrical light beam (50) from the second conical lens (5), to form a hollow-cone light beam (60) and to focus said hollow-cone light beam (60) at one point (18) of micrometric size in the image focal plane (12).
